import { Agent } from "@mastra/core/agent";
import { createMCPClient } from "@mastra/mcp";
import { openai } from "@ai-sdk/openai";
async function main() {
// Your Vinkius token. get it at cloud.vinkius.com
const mcpClient = await createMCPClient({
servers: {
"umami-privacy-analytics": {
url: "https://edge.vinkius.com/[YOUR_TOKEN_HERE]/mcp",
},
},
});
const tools = await mcpClient.getTools();
const agent = new Agent({
name: "Umami (Privacy Analytics) Agent",
instructions:
"You help users interact with Umami (Privacy Analytics) " +
"using 53 tools.",
model: openai("gpt-4o"),
tools,
});
const result = await agent.generate(
"What can I do with Umami (Privacy Analytics)?"
);
console.log(result.text);
}
main();

About Umami (Privacy Analytics) MCP Server
Connect your Umami instance to any AI agent to monitor your privacy-focused analytics and manage your infrastructure through natural language. Umami is the open-source, privacy-friendly alternative to Google Analytics, and this MCP server gives you full control over your data.
Mastra's agent abstraction provides a clean separation between LLM logic and Umami (Privacy Analytics) tool infrastructure. Connect 53 tools through Vinkius and use Mastra's built-in workflow engine to chain tool calls with conditional logic, retries, and parallel execution. deployable to any Node.js host in one command.
What you can do
- Event Tracking — Send custom events and page views directly to your Umami instance using the
send_eventtool. - Website Management — List and manage all websites associated with your account or the entire instance using
get_me_websitesoradmin_list_websites. - User & Team Administration — Perform administrative tasks like creating, updating, or deleting users and managing teams with tools like
create_userandadmin_list_teams. - Session Insights — Retrieve information about your current session and authorized access levels using
get_me. - Self-Hosted Support — Seamlessly connect to your own infrastructure using the
logintool to authenticate and retrieve tokens.
